a:link {color: #2F250E; text-decoration: none}
a:visited {color: #2F250E; text-decoration: none}
a:hover  {color: #917129; text-decoration: none}

a.link:link {color: #917129; text-decoration: none}
a.link:visited {color: #7D611F; text-decoration: none}
a.link:hover  {color: #917129; text-decoration: none}

* {
		margin:0;
		padding:0;
		}

	html, body {
		height:100%;
		}

	body {
		background-color:#2F250E;
		text-align:center; /* horizontal centering for IE Win quirks */
		}
		
	#distance { 
		width:1px;
		height:50%;
		background-color:#2F250E;
		margin-bottom:-315px; /* half of container's height */
		float:left;
		}		
		
	#container {
		margin:0 auto;
		position:relative; /* puts container in front of distance */
		text-align:left;
		height:630px;
		width:900px;
		clear:left;
		background-color:#D3C6A9;
		}

	table {
   color: #F7F7F7; 
   font-size: 12px; 
   font-weight:500; 
   font-family: Arial;   
		}		


#home {
	position:absolute;
	top:28px;
	left: 183px;
	width: 705px;
	height:598px;
	font-size: 12px;
	font-weight:500;
	font-family: Arial;
	visibility: visible;
	overflow: auto;
}

#main {
   position:absolute;
   top:45px;
   width:681px;   
   color: #F7F7F7; 
   font-size: 12px; 
   font-weight:500; 
   font-family: Arial;   
   float: left;
}

#main2 {
   position:absolute;
   top:45px;
   width:681px;   
   height:100%;
   color: #F7F7F7; 
   font-size: 12px; 
   font-weight:500; 
   font-family: Arial;   
   float: left;
}

#left {
   position:absolute;
   top:115px;
   left:10px;
   width:175px; 
   height:263px;
   float: left;
   color: #D3C6A9; 
   font-size: 15px; 
   font-weight:600; 
   font-family: Arial;
   letter-spacing: 3px;
}

#right {
   position:absolute;
   top:115px;
   left: 722px;
   width:150px; 
   height:263px;
   font-size: 12px; 
   font-weight:500; 
   font-family: Arial;
   float:right;
   }
   
#bottom {
	position:absolute;
	top: 471px;
	left: 183px;
	width:700px;
	font-size: 12px;
	font-weight:500;
	font-family: Arial;
   }   
   
#top {
   position: relative;
   width:221px; 
   height:214px;
   float: left;
   }  
   
#top2 {
   position: relative;
   width:600px; 
   height:273px;
   }    

		


.button {color: #000000; font-size: 10px; font-weight:500; font-family: Arial; background-color:#ECEBEB; border:1px solid #2B2B3A;}
.input, textarea {color: #000000; font-size: 10px; font-weight:500; font-family: Arial; background-color:#ECEBEB; border:1px solid #2B2B3A;}
.textarea {color: #000000; font-size: 11px; font-weight:500; font-family: Arial; background-color:#D7D8DC; border:1px solid #2B2B3A;}
option {color: #000000; font-size: 11px; font-weight:500; font-family: Arial; background-color:#D7D8DC; border:1px solid #2B2B3A; scrollbar-base-color: #C4CAD1; scrollbar-darkshadow-color: #C4CAD1; scrollbar-face-color: #C4CAD1; scrollbar-track-color:#C4CAD1; scrollbar-arrow-color: #646B73; scrollbar-3dlight-color: #C4CAD1;}
select {color: #000000; font-size: 11px; font-weight:500; font-family: Arial; background-color:#D7D8DC; border:1px solid #2B2B3A; scrollbar-base-color: #C4CAD1; scrollbar-darkshadow-color: #C4CAD1; scrollbar-face-color: #C4CAD1; scrollbar-track-color:#C4CAD1; scrollbar-arrow-color: #646B73; scrollbar-3dlight-color: #C4CAD1;}
.menu {font-size: 14px; font-family: Tahoma; margin-top: 13px; margin-left: 15px;}
.text {color: #7D611F; font-size: 12px; font-weight:500; font-family: Arial }
.bio {color: #000000; font-size: 12px; font-weight:500; font-family: Arial }
.imp {color: #7D611F; font-size: 10px; font-weight:400; font-family: Arial }
.active {color: #917129; font-size: 15px; font-weight:600; font-family: Arial }
.textklein {color: #F7F7F7; font-size: 10px; font-weight:500; font-family: Arial }
.gb {color: #C4C4C4; font-size: 10px; font-weight:500; font-family: Arial }
.text1 {color: #878787; font-size: 10px; font-weight:500; letter-spacing:1px; font-family: Arial }
.status {color: #CACACA; font-size: 10px; font-weight:400; font-family: Arial }
.klein {color: #000000; font-size: 1px; font-weight:400; font-family: Tahoma, Arial }
.textweiss {color: #FFFFFF; font-size: 12px; font-weight:500; font-family: Arial }
.kleinweiss {color: #FFFFFF; font-size: 10px; font-weight:500; font-family: Arial }
.textrot {color: #D91217; font-size: 11px; font-weight:600; font-family: Arial;}
.textweiss2 {color: #FFFFFF; font-size: 11px; font-weight:600; font-family: Tahoma, Arial }
.untertitel {color: #F7F7F7; font-size: 12px; font-weight:500; font-family: Arial }
.titel {color: #7D611F; font-size: 12px; font-weight:600; font-family: Arial }
.blau {color: #0072A8; font-size: 11px; font-weight:700; font-stretch:expanded; font-family: Arial }
.titelrot {color: #D91217; font-size: 12px; font-weight:700; font-family: Arial }
.littletext {color: #535351; font-size: 10px; font-family: Tahoma }
.texttitel {color: #535351; font-size: 12px; font-family: Tahoma;}
.comment {color: #424583; font-size: 9pt; font-family: Arial }
.linktitel {color: #C4C4C4; font-size: 11.5px; font-weight:600; font-family: Arial }
.kommentar {color: #535351; font-size: 12px; font-family: Tahoma;}
.tabellentitel {color: #DC9835; font-size: 12px; font-family: Tahoma;}
